About this listen

Meet Aziza, New York City's premier Fairy Glamother—a magical defender of creative women with custom dragonfly wings and impeccable taste in vintage Chanel. When the supernatural world collides with Manhattan's glittering fashion and entertainment scenes, Aziza steps in where the NYPD can't tread.

In this complete collection, follow Aziza as she navigates both the cutthroat human world and the magical realm of Freehollow beneath the city. With her psychopomp paramour Claude and wealthy Xana protégée Raquel by her side, Aziza confronts elven kidnappers, magical murderers, and otherworldly thieves targeting the city's most brilliant creative talents.

From missing models to murdered designers to photographers whose cameras capture more than just images, each case forces Aziza to embrace her fairy heritage and glamour powers in new ways. As designer gowns become armor and Fashion Week turns deadly, Aziza proves that justice should always be dressed to kill.

Perfect for fans who love their urban fantasy with equal parts magic and Manhattan sophistication, this collection offers three complete supernatural mysteries where haute couture meets the uncanny, and stilettos can be just as dangerous as spells.
